Notes — Prunebot review, 03 Mar

Bot deletes branches stale >90 days on the Gantleby monorepo. Exclusions: release/*, hotfix/*, anything with an open PR. Dry-run mode flag lives in prunebot.toml; leave it on in forks. Known issue: tag-only branches get flagged falsely — fix deferred. Agreed: no auto-delete on Fridays. Maintainers should update the exclusion list before adding new long-lived branch prefixes. Audit log retained one year. Escalation path for disputed deletions runs through the owner named below.

named custodian: Brivan Eliath Quenox Frador

14:37 — Relevance tuning change for Mistral Grove search went live. The notes doc said the phrase-boost rollout was staged at 10%, but the config actually applied it globally, which skewed click-through tracking for about forty minutes. Priya reverted to the prior weights and re-staged correctly. If you're new: always cross-check the tuning notes against the deployed config, not just the PR description. The rollback deploy that restored baseline behavior carries the identifier shown below.

build token for kagaf-hahof: htk14_9d3d4d26d7d8de

## Tollgate Partnership — Term Sheet Summary (Managers Only)

Quick rundown for department heads: Ferndale Systems sent over their revised term sheet for the Tollgate integration. Headline points — two-year exclusivity in the Westmoor region, revenue share at 70/30 in our favour, and a joint support desk staffed by both sides. Legal flagged the IP clause as workable but wants tighter language on derivatives. Overall, better than round one. How this fits our roadmap is summarised just below.

confidential, kagup-bafog: Fraaxax Group is in early talks to buy Soroxox Group for about $343.8 million. The Olidor launch date is June 14, and nothing goes to the press before then. Legal wants the Aldmirek Logistics term sheet signed before July 23.

Quarterly Planning Note — Branch Managers, Rillstone Hardware

Hi all — quick word on pricing for the Fenwick tool line next quarter. We're holding list prices steady but trimming the bulk-order discount from 12% to 9%, since margins have been getting squeezed by freight. Expect some pushback from trade accounts; the talking points deck goes out Friday. Seasonal promos on the Fenwick Pro kits stay as planned. One more thing you need before customer conversations start — the confidential pricing plan follows below.

management briefing: Project Ulavan slips by two quarters because of the staffing delay.